This project is a DC-coupled system that leverages the abundant sunlight in the Kyushu region. By allowing PV generation to prioritize grid feed-in during the day while storing surplus energy to charge batteries, and discharging the batteries at night, this PV-plus-battery project achieves 24-hour electricity sales, maximizing the owner's revenue.
Japan DC-Coupled System
Location: Japan
7.74MW/15.48MWh
